Transaction 124b3a52cb0906dfcb9512a425ff20a60c815af0c36ae50e50de2e901e14bf60

1 Input
2 Outputs
  • 124b3a52cb0906dfcb9512a425ff20a60c815af0c36ae50e50de2e901e14bf60:0
  • value  30747777
    address  3Qc295He4b731NMiqAVMfbvS376jQhZZfX
  • 124b3a52cb0906dfcb9512a425ff20a60c815af0c36ae50e50de2e901e14bf60:1
  • value  98730
    address  3P5uWhp9WH8kq21R1FjFhvqVt8Es2VMjBf